E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
observer协处理器
RunLoop 的接口
有5个类:CFRunLoopRefCFRunLoopModeRefCFRunLoopSourceRefCFRunLoopTimerRef基于时间的触发器,基本上说的就是NSTimerCFRunLoop
Observer
Ref
Stago
·
2021-04-27 19:25
【Vue源码】数据响应式原理 - 依赖收集 - defineReactive -
Observer
- Dep - Watcher
1.定义defineReactive函数1.1Why(临时变量)1.2How(闭包)2.对象的响应式处理——递归侦测对象全部属性object2.1Why(嵌套)2.2How(递归)observe.js
Observer
.jsdef.jsdefineReactive.js2.3
YK菌
·
2021-04-27 18:56
前端框架Vue
javascript
vue
痞子衡嵌入式:利用i.MXRT1xxx系列内部DCP引擎计算Hash值时需特别处理L1 D-Cache
关于i.MXRT1xxx系列内部通用数据
协处理器
DCP模块,痞子衡之前写过一篇文章《SNVSMasterKey仅在i.MXRT10xxHab关闭时才能用于DCP加解密》介绍了DCP基本功能和AES加解密使用注意事项
痞子衡
·
2021-04-27 17:00
ZooKeeper 源码分析 集群各个成员及相关概念 (基于3.4.6)
follower经过半数ACK回应之后Leader才会正真执行Request2.lead操作(方法leader.lead())3.使用LearnerCnxAcceptor监听端口,监听Follower/
Observer
爱吃鱼的KK
·
2021-04-27 16:57
Retrofit + 协程 + Lifecycle 封装实战
现在好了,下面通过对Retrofit的扩展,让你摆脱这些痛苦框架设计框架图如图:拓展Retrofit实现Lifecycle
Observer
接口,感知Activity的生命周期全靠它了,加入kot
i校长
·
2021-04-27 13:43
iOS 趣谈设计模式——通知
【前言介绍】iOS的一种设计模式,观察者
Observer
模式(也叫发布/订阅,即Publich/Subscribe模式)。
啊左
·
2021-04-27 13:00
Java 观察者模式
简单理解,多个
Observer
可以订阅一个Subject,如果Subject有什么更新,通知
Observer
。
奔跑的笨鸟
·
2021-04-27 12:13
Rxjava(一)初试
一、这里记录一些关键性的词1、
Observer
观察者,Observable被观察者2、subscribe订阅,subscribe()订阅的方法3、onNext()回调,相当于onClick()4、onCom
键盘上的麒麟臂
·
2021-04-27 05:02
[天天用英语 2017.1.2] - Not a Drill: SETI Is Investigating a Possible Extraterrestrial Signal From Deep Space
http://
observer
.com/2016/08/not-a-drill-seti-is-investigating-a-possible-extraterrestrial-signal-from-deep-space
terry_tang
·
2021-04-27 01:42
Resize
Observer
API详解
Resize
Observer
API是一个新的JavaScriptAPI,与允许我们去监听某个元素的宽高变化。
glorydx
·
2021-04-27 00:00
前端逻辑基础
onresize
resizeObsever
监听页面大小变化
iOS NSNotification
一、注册(即add
Observer
)A、如果注册写在viewDidLoad中,则移除监听要写在dealloc中;B、如果注册写在viewWillAppear中,则移除监听要写在viewWillDisappear
想想8606
·
2021-04-26 13:46
Android开发之小白使用RxAndroid
需要了解的概念Observable(被观察者)
Observer
/Subscriber(观察者)Observable发出一系列事件他是
gyymz1993
·
2021-04-26 11:59
利用
Observer
(观察者)模式实现多选框的全选
一、什么是
Observer
(观察者)模式
Observer
(观察者)是一种设计模式,其中,一个对象(subject)维持一系列依赖于它(观察者)的对象,将有关状态的任何变更自动通知给他们。
WaNgLu:)
·
2021-04-26 09:27
前端
设计模式
js
javascript
深入浅出 KVO
前言KVO(keyvalueobserving)键值监听是我们在开发中常使用的用于监听特定对象属性值变化的方法,常用于监听数据模型的变化.KVO常用方法/*注册监听器
observer
:监听器对象为
observer
我叫王可可
·
2021-04-25 19:26
event loop
检查微任务,依次执行//执行浏览器UI现成的渲染工作//检查是否有webworker任务,有就执行这个//执行完本轮的宏任务,回到第二步,再次旬换,直到微任务和宏任务队列全部为空//微任务:Mutation
Observer
skoll
·
2021-04-25 14:03
Rxjava2 Observable的辅助操作详解及实例(一)
Observer
O
JiangMing_JIM
·
2021-04-25 11:13
java图像处理干货篇
图像处理干货篇绘制图像绘制图像主要用到的是Graphics类中drawImage方法,当然Graphics2D中也有相应的方法主要的用法:publicabstractbooleandrawImage(Imageimg,x,y,Image
Observer
observer
爱撒谎的男孩
·
2021-04-25 04:40
键盘监听事件
//增加监听,当键盘出现或改变时收出消息[[NSNotificationCenterdefaultCenter]add
Observer
:selfselector:@selector(keyboardWillShow
孟维学
·
2021-04-25 00:43
iOS小记--调用pop方式返回,但是当前控制器没有被释放的解决方式
但是在今天下午真的是遇到了一个令人悲伤的BUG.我在一个控制器里:通知监听页(B)注册了几个通知的监听方法,其中一个通知只在这个控制器(B)里注册了监听,然后在下一个控制器(C)发送通知,通知的post方只有一个,通知的
observer
inxx
·
2021-04-24 19:19
ReactiveCocoa(RAC)学习笔记
代替通知:rac_add
Observer
ForName:用于监听某个通知。监听文本框文字改变:rac_t
嘹亮的浩哥
·
2021-04-24 18:28
KVO观察者的注册、响应、清除对象
add
Observer
:forKeyPath:options:context:各个参数的作用分别是什么?
observer
中需要实现哪个方法才能获得KVO回调?
wayne0207
·
2021-04-24 16:54
CentOS安装NodeJS及Express开发框架
[root@B
obServer
Stationlocal]#yum-yinstallgccgcc-c++openssl-develStep2、下载NodeJS源码包并解压[root@B
obServer
Stationlocal
小k博客
·
2021-04-24 12:22
IOS监听键盘
前两个通知不是每次都能监听到,但是最后一个通知是每次键盘变化都一定能监听到的[[NSNotificationCenterdefaultCenter]add
Observer
:selfselector:@selector
走道牙的人
·
2021-04-23 14:44
Java通俗易懂系列设计模式之观察者模式
在观察者模式中,监视另一个对象状态的对象称为
Observer
,正在被监视的对象称为Subject。
·
2021-04-23 12:25
NSNotification
提供了一种"同步的"消息通知机制观察者只要向消息中心注册,即可接受其他对象发送来的消息使用消息机制的步骤:a.观察者注册消息通知[[NSNotificationCenterdefaultCenter]add
Observer
Crazy2015
·
2021-04-23 10:43
OC中键盘的处理
使用通知的方法1.监听键盘通知-(void)viewDidLoad{[superviewDidLoad];//监听键盘通知[[NSNotificationCenterdefaultCenter]add
Observer
打电话记错号码的人
·
2021-04-22 15:21
如何使用KVO
用法KVO键值观察,使用起来非常方便举个例子:比如你想要再某个值改变的时候执行一个方法(每次改变都要执行)你只需要坐到以下两点即可:给某对象添加观察者[某对象add
Observer
:selfforKeyPath
yyMae
·
2021-04-22 10:08
微信小程序:自定义组件,数据监听器的使用
提示:微信小程序自定义组件的使用,数据监听,小案例slide(控制背景色rgb颜色变化)文章目录前言一、自定义组件的使用创建自定义组件二、微信小程序数据监听(
observer
)是什么?
辣可乐少加冰
·
2021-04-22 08:02
前端
小程序
iOS ---观察者模式
观察者模式本质上时一种发布-订阅模型,用以消除具有不同行为的对象之间的耦合,通过这一模式,不同对象可以协同工作,同时它们也可以被复用于其他地方
Observer
从Subject订阅通知,Concrete
Observer
PlatonsDream
·
2021-04-21 23:51
记录Android开发中测量view宽高的几种方法
privateViewMeasureUtil(){}//在Activity的onCreate()方法中获取view的尺寸publicstaticvoidmeasureSize(Viewview,ViewTree
Observer
.OnGlobalLayoutListenerlistener
小牛的回忆
·
2021-04-21 21:00
iOS 设计模式--观察者模式 -
Observer
在观察者模式里,一个对象在状态变化的时候会通知另一个对象。参与者并不需要知道其他对象的具体是干什么的-这是一种降低耦合度的设计。这个设计模式常用于在某个属性改变的时候通知关注该属性的对象。常见的使用方法是观察者注册监听,然后再状态改变的时候,所有观察者们都会收到通知。在MVC里,观察者模式意味着需要允许Model对象和View对象进行交流,而不能有直接的关联。Cocoa使用两种方式实现了观察者模式
偉7811
·
2021-04-21 20:30
二十、
Observer
观察者模式
Paste_Image.pngPaste_Image.pngPaste_Image.pngPaste_Image.pngPaste_Image.pngPaste_Image.pngPaste_Image.pngPaste_Image.pngPaste_Image.pngPaste_Image.pngPaste_Image.pngPaste_Image.pngPaste_Image.pngPaste
lmem
·
2021-04-21 19:14
【Android Jetpack高手日志】LiveData 从入门到精通
它是生命周期感知型组件,实现生命周期管理的一致性,在内部进行了统一的生命周期状态管理,可以很方便的提供给其他的组件(比如LiveData,ViewModel)使用,同时其他类还能够通过实现Lifecycle
Observer
沈页
·
2021-04-21 15:04
android
Jetpack
Android进阶
android
移动开发
jetpack
Vuejs学习系列(十四)---vue实例的生命周期(二)
他们是:·beforeCreate在实例初始化之后,数据观测(data
observer
)和event/watcher事件配置之前被调用。·created实例已经创建完成之后被调用。
博为峰51Code教研组
·
2021-04-21 11:23
键盘显隐监听
/***类描述:键盘显隐监听*创建人:吴冬冬*创建时间:2019/8/1215:26*/publicclassKeyBoardListenerimplementsViewTree
Observer
.OnGlobalLayoutListener
Thor_果冻
·
2021-04-21 04:58
观察者模式
观察者(
Observer
)模式的定义:指多个对象间存在一对多的依赖关系,当一个对象的状态发生改变时,所有依赖于它的对象都得到通知并被自动更新。观察者模式是一种对象行为型模式,其主要优点如下。
打工养老板
·
2021-04-21 03:39
Vue一些原理总结
vue.js采用数据劫持结合发布-订阅模式,通过Object.defineproperty来劫持各个属性的setter,getter,在数据变动时发布消息给订阅者,触发响应的监听回调原理图分析核心实现类
Observer
xiaobangsky
·
2021-04-20 15:32
前端精进
vue
Mobox-学习
Mobox中常用的标签@observable:使用此标签监控要检测的数据@
observer
:使用此标签监控当数据变化是要更新的Component(组件类)autorun:当观测到的数据发生变化的时候,如果变化的值处在
三季人
·
2021-04-20 11:57
Swiper隐藏后在显示时没有宽高,(swiper中动态渲染数据出现划不动)
newSwiper('.swiper-container',{slidesPerView:2.5,freeMode:true,spaceBetween:8,scrollbar:'.swiper-scrollbar',
observer
无名小码农
·
2021-04-20 11:50
RxJava->onCreate()与subscribe()
Overridepublicvoidsubscribe(ObservableEmitteremitter)throwsException{emitter.onNext(1);emitter.onComplete();}}).subscribe(new
Observer
冉桓彬
·
2021-04-20 07:31
IEEE-754浮点标准简介
70年代末,实数(十进制数)被不同的计算机厂商表示成不同的二进制形式,这使得许多程序与不同的机器不兼容.1980年IEEE委员会将实数的浮点数据表示进行了标准化.该标准大部分由Intel基于8087数学
协处理器
定制的
cntlb
·
2021-04-20 03:52
观察者设计模式
观察者设计模式需要以下两个程序类和接口:观察者:
Observer
接口,该类有一个方法update,当该方法执行后,观察者就会进行相应的响应。被观察者:Observable类。
小孩真笨
·
2021-04-19 23:26
Hbase的预分区和协调处理器
Hbase的预分区和协调处理器HBase的预分区HBase的rowKey设计技巧:HBase的
协处理器
附:与HUE的整合HBase的预分区预分区的作用:增加数据读写效率负载均衡,防止数据倾斜方便集群容灾调度
KujyouRuri
·
2021-04-19 12:45
设计模式-观察者模式(
Observer
Pattern)
应用场景Spring的Event监听订单成功后的邮件短信及活动发放分布式配置中心刷新配置Zookeeper事件通知节点消息订阅通知安卓开发事件注册JDK自带的观察者Jdk中Observable与
ObServer
架构师_迦叶
·
2021-04-19 10:41
RxJava初识1
RxJava中的三大主角即:观察者
Observer
,被观察者Observable,订阅subscrib另外还有调度器Scheduler,调度器并非必须存在的一个角色,如果一个异步操作不指定线程则默认运行在发起调用的线程
大写的口可口可
·
2021-04-19 09:31
设计模式-装饰模式(Decorator Pattern)
上一篇>>观察者模式(
Observer
Pattern)装饰模式:动态地给一个对象添加一些额外的职责,它比生成子类方式更为灵活。
架构师_迦叶
·
2021-04-18 21:24
RxJava2 中多种取消订阅 dispose 的方法梳理( 源码分析 )
这样也能取消,那样也能取消,没能系统起来的感觉就像掉进了盘丝洞,迷乱...下面说说这几种情况几种取消的情况subscribe时返回了disposable:subscribe不返回disposable,从
observer
叽哩叽哩鸡
·
2021-04-18 15:45
vue数据响应式
在具体实现上,vue用到了几个核心部件:
Observer
DepWatcherScheduler
Observer
Observer
要实现的目标非常简单,就是把一个普通的对象转换为响应式的对象为了实现这一点,
搁浅.........
·
2021-04-16 00:01
vue.js
vue
vue的数据响应原理
数据响应原理简单简述运行过程1、首先是传入原始对象,使用
Observer
,通过其getter和setter方法把数据变成响应式数据;2、在设置和获取数据时,在进行渲染时(执行render函数时)会产生一个
井底的蜗牛
·
2021-04-13 22:08
vue
vue
Android 截屏分享
解决方案1、File
Observer
监听截图文件目录数据改变。2、ContentProvider监听数据的改变。
巴黎没有摩天轮Li
·
2021-04-13 16:01
上一页
49
50
51
52
53
54
55
56
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他